Reading Days. Thursday and Friday of the last week of classes each semester will be designated as Reading Days (Thursday, May 8, and Friday, May 9, 2008). Classes will be suspended but professors may hold study sessions to review previous coursework. No new material may be introduced at study sessions. The Wednesday prior to finals week will be designated the last day of classes.

Finals for Graduating Seniors. In the spring semester, graduating seniors take final examinations during the last week of regularly scheduled classes.

Completion of Work. To be counted as work completed in the course, all papers, reports, drawings, computer programs or projects, or other assigned exercises must be turned in to instructors by the course’s regularly scheduled final exam time each semester, unless an earlier date has been specified by the instructor.

Final Examinations. Final examinations in all courses may be required at the option of instructors. If required, such examinations must also be taken by seniors in their final semester, although their final examinations need not be equivalent in size or length to those required of other students.

INSTRUCTORS MAY NOT CHANGE FINAL EXAMINATION DATES WITHOUT THE CONSENT OF THE ACADEMIC PROCEDURES COMMITTEE.
Examinations for individual students may not be given at other than the scheduled times or places except by consent of the Academic Procedures Committee. During the last five days of any semester, no final examinations shall be given, and no extra class meetings outside the normal class schedule may be scheduled. These restrictions do not apply to voluntary review sessions or to final examinations for seniors in their last semester.
